For a charity, getting noticed is essential to mobilizing support, raising funds and having a significant impact on its mission. The mobile phone is omnipresent in our daily lives. As a result, SMS is an essential tool to strengthen the visibility and effectiveness of a charity. Charities play a crucial role in society. To maximize their impact and performance, they must adopt an effective communication strategy. SMS offers multiple advantages for increasing visibility, mobilizing members and, above all, for collecting donations. Whether in the event of a crisis, emergency or last-minute change, SMS allows for instant alerting . For example, in the event of a natural disaster such as a flood or storm, members of a charity need to be informed quickly of needs and actions to be taken. SMS alerts therefore facilitate the transmission of information. 2- Motivational messages In order to maintain the enthusiasm and motivation of members, it is necessary to remind them how crucial their involvement is.
You can send motivational messages by SMS to value the work of your members by reminding them of the importance of their commitment to the association. For example, you can communicate the successes and progress of the association's projects to your members via SMS. They will feel involved and this will strengthen the sense of belonging, which will encourage them to stay engaged. Don't forget to send a thank you message to your members for any help you provide. This little touch will let them know that their efforts have not gone unnoticed and will encourage them to continue their support in the future.
3- Membership Updates Take advantage of the many benefits of SMS for your association’s membership management. You can send personalized SMS reminders to members before their membership expires. These reminders allow members to renew their membership and stay engaged with the charity. Additionally, SMS can be used to send membership confirmation messages, membership policy updates, or membership benefits.
